摘要: 心理干预是指运用心理手段,对存在心理问题的个人或集体采取明确、有效的措施,使其获得心理健康的有关过程。随着运动员的心理问题日益凸显,心理干预近年来在竞技体育领域开始受到重视,并催生出大量应用。本文梳理了心理干预的一般方法及其在竞技体育中的具体应用,并对国外为体育实践提供心理服务的相关组织机构进行了剖析。以之为基础,对该领域未来相关研究的开展与干预体系的建构等内容进行了进一步展望,以期更好地服务于国内有关实践。
Abstract: Psychological intervention refers to the use of psychological means to take clear and effective measures for individuals or groups with psychological problems to obtain mental health. As the psychological problems of athletes have become increasingly prominent, psychological intervention has begun to receive attention in the field of competitive sports in recent years and has spawned numerous applications. This article summarizes the general methods of psychological intervention and its specific application in competitive sports, and analyzes the relevant organizations abroad that provide psychological services for sports practice. Based on this, the future research on this field and the construction of the intervention system are further prospected, with a view to better serving relevant domestic practices.
